Styling kitchen countertops can be a huge challenge. On the one hand, you want your kitchen counter to be perfectly decorated and beautifully styled. Still, on the other, you don’t want your limited counter space to feel cluttered or decorated with items that conflict with practical functions, like preparing food.

When decorating kitchen countertops, we like to keep it simple. Here are some creative ideas for kitchen counter decorations to create clutter-free, clean, and elegant countertops.

Great Ideas for Kitchen Counter Decorations

1. Fresh Flowers

Flowers are one of the most common kitchen counter decor ideas and are popular for a good reason. A vase of vibrant flowers adds a “pop” of color to any kitchen, and the fragrant blooming buds can envelop your kitchen in a sweet aroma. For something more practical, consider keeping a few small vases with fresh herbs on the kitchen island to add to your favorite recipes.

If you don’t want to worry about the hassle (or added cost) or purchasing new flowers each week, faux greenery is a great way to decorate kitchen counters. Pop some sprigs of eucalyptus into a vase or string strands of greenery along the top of your kitchen cabinets or open shelves.

2. Attractive Appliances

Now hear us out — cluttering your kitchen with unattractive small appliances, like blenders, pressure cookers, and toasters, isn’t a good idea (regardless of how much you use them). These kitchen tools and everyday items can be an eyesore and are better stored in the pantry or kitchen cabinets. 

However, choosing a few attractive appliances to display on your kitchen countertops is an excellent use of functional decor, especially for a small kitchen. For example, many people place a stand mixer, like a KitchenAid, in the corner of their counter or put a sleek stainless-steel toaster oven on display. We’re a fan of creating a coffee station with a stylish coffee maker or espresso machine on the counter with coffee beans, syrups, sauces, and mugs on display.

3. Delicious Food

Some amazing ideas for decorating kitchen countertops are as easy as displaying the food you’ve already made. Here are some super simple ideas:

  • Bowl of Fruit — Add colorful fruit, like apples, bananas, and oranges, to a fruit bowl on the countertop. You’ll probably eat healthy with all the fruit in easy reach, too, which is a bonus!
  • Cookie Jar — Keep cookies or other treats in a jar on the kitchen island for a sweet treat (and adorable decoration!) that visitors, especially kids, will love.
  • Bread Boards — If you’re a bread-baking enthusiast, invest in a beautiful breadboard or small tray to display your latest loaf on the countertop.

4. Cooking Corner

Consider displaying all your cooking essentials, like cooking utensils, cutting boards, olive oil, salt and pepper shakers, and other frequently used herbs and spices, on a wooden tray on your countertop.

Not only does this cooking tray serve as countertop decor, but when you head downstairs to cook dinner or wake up to scramble some eggs for breakfast, you’ll have all the essentials you need within arm’s reach for food prep.

5. Beautiful Cookbooks

Do you find yourself referring back to a specific cookbook time and time again when you need meal inspiration? Consider purchasing a cookbook stand to display your favorite cookbook!

Not only is a cookbook stand functional and practical (it makes the instructions easy to read when your hands are otherwise occupied with chopping, slicing, and dicing), but a well-designed cookbook is one of the best accessories for decorating a kitchen counter.

6. Practical Cleaning Items

Before overhauling your kitchen decor to spruce up your countertops, think of small changes you can make that won’t break the bank.

For example, you probably keep a bottle of soap by the kitchen sink, right? Consider upgrading to refillable soap dispensers with a stylish pattern or design. They’re better for the environment and can add beauty to your kitchen. Similarly, you can keep dish soap in an oil dispenser on your countertop. Not only is it more stylish, but you’ll use less soap while doing the dishes. It’s a total win-win!

Another thing to think about — do you have a prep space on the kitchen counter with a cutting board, knife block, and utensil holders? Try swapping out plastic cutting boards with a high-quality wooden board that will last for years, and upgrade mismatched utensils for a matching set for a cohesive look.
